Fifteen-year-old reported missing after boarding bus, Boston MA
A 15-year-old was reported missing after boarding a bus near Forest Hills / Woodbourne in Boston. Transit Police have not been able to contact the youth since they left home around 5 p.m. Officers were dispatched to the Forest Hills busway to assist in locating the individual.
